<p>1.  Sign up to <a title="task manager - remember the milk" href="http://www.rememberthemilk.com/" target="_blank">www.rememberthemilk.com</a> to manage tasks and not forget anything (hopefully)</p>
<p>2.  Set up a fan page on Facebook as a great way to market virally for free.</p>
<p>This is better than setting up a group for lots of reasons but the major one I saw straight away is that you can contact your fan base quickly and with NO restrictions on the number of people you are messaging (unlike groups).  Fantastic for publicising events, letting your INTERESTED fans know of new products and providing easy interaction with forums, comments etc.  And it&#8217;s easy for your fans to invite all their friends to join too and each time someone joins it goes on their newsfeed with a link&#8230; think about it&#8230;</p>
